What is an electrical insulator, and why is it important in Virginia Beach wiring?

An electrical insulator is a material that resists the flow of electric current, preventing electricity from escaping its intended path. In Virginia Beach wiring, common insulating materials include the plastic or rubberized coatings found on copper wires, as well as porcelain or fiberglass used in stand-off insulators. These insulators are critical for safety, ensuring that live conductors do not come into contact with conductive surfaces like metal conduits or building frames, which could cause short circuits or electric shock. Proper insulation is a fundamental aspect of safe electrical installations in any environment.

What are the considerations for installing an electrical outlet extender or adapter in Virginia Beach?

When considering an electrical outlet extender or adapter in Virginia Beach, it's important to use them judiciously and understand their limitations. While convenient for temporary needs, they can pose a fire risk if overloaded with high-wattage devices. Licensed electricians recommend installing additional permanent outlets if you consistently need more power points. Always ensure any extender used is rated appropriately for the connected devices and that the circuit it's plugged into is not already near its capacity. For long-term solutions, consult a professional for safe, code-compliant additions.

What are the best practices for electrical building wiring in Virginia Beach's climate?

Electrical building wiring in Virginia Beach's climate requires specific considerations due to humidity and proximity to salt air. Professionals prioritize using corrosion-resistant materials, especially for outdoor installations or near the coast, such as appropriately rated conduit and weatherproof boxes. Ensuring proper grounding and bonding is critical to mitigate lightning strike risks, which can be more prevalent in coastal regions. The use of high-quality copper wiring with appropriate insulation and adherence to NEC standards for ventilation and protection against moisture ingress are paramount for long-term safety and system reliability.

What is involved in installing an electric car charger for home use in Virginia Beach?

Installing an electric car charger for home use in Virginia Beach typically involves a licensed electrician assessing your existing electrical panel's capacity and potentially upgrading it if necessary. They will then run a dedicated circuit, often requiring specific gauge copper wiring and a dual-pole breaker, to the location where the charger will be installed. The charger unit itself will be mounted, and its wiring will be connected according to manufacturer specifications and NEC guidelines, ensuring safe and efficient charging for your electric vehicle. Proper grounding and GFCI protection are also essential components.
